いろは唄 (Iroha Uta)
By: 銀サク (Ginsaku)
Difficulty: Extreme (8)
Grade: Excellent
Module: Kagerou (Heat Haze)

Previously featured in the arcade version, Iroha Uta makes its debut on PSP. Most of this isn't too bad, but the guitar solo is pretty rough as well as the placement of the triples near the end. It's kind of funny that the actual Chance Time segment is dead easy compared to the sections immediately before and after it, heh.
